FTC – FC Barcelona 0-3
Three-goal defeat from Barcelona on the last Champions League home match.

Ferencváros Budapest was hosting tonight its last home game in the UEFA Champions League for this year. The opponent was FC Barcelona who beat us 5-1 in Barcelona a little over one month ago. The opponents showed in the first half that they definitely are one of the world’s best teams and before long took a 3-0 lead. Koeman’s team created a chain of attacks and first Griezmann finished an attempt, then Dembelé scored two more goals, the second one from a penalty. In the second half Ferencváros came up and played more evenly against Barcelona. Although we had our chances and the substitutes brought more initiative and new energy to the pitch, we did not manage to score today, but Barcelona did not extend further its lead either.
 
Although we left the pitch with a defeat today, the most important match is yet to come against Dynamo Kiev next week. The winner of that match will go to the Europa League spring rounds.
